The quarter-finals of  P1000 from Lattes Padel Club  kept their promises with  several surprises  and a picture that clearly opens up as the final square approaches.

 The 3rd and 4th seeds are out. 

First big piece of information: the  fall of the top seed 3 ,  du Gardin / Sanchez , beaten in the quarter-finals by the  TS8 Tullou / Vial A real surprise that completely reshuffles this part of the picture.

Another striking fact was the early elimination of the  TS4 Étienne / Le Panse eliminated in the round of 16 by  Armand / Master which confirm their rise to power.

 Brechemier / Solid and efficient water bottles 

La  TS2 Rémi Gourre / Thomas Brechemier  held its own against  Armand / Pasquier (TS7)  with a win  6 / 4 6 / 3  in less than an hour.

A closer match than it seems:

  • So many opportunities for a break on both sides
  • but better management of key moments on the TS2 side

Armand and Pasquier led in the first set, without capitalizing, before faltering in the important moments.

 Armand / Master impress 

Great performance of  Master / Armand , which dominate  Perrin / Cipri   7 / 6 6 / 0 .

After a close first set, the second was  one-way  :

  • Master wreaks havoc with his smash
  • Armand ultra solid
  • On the other side, there was no further response.

A clear victory that propels them as  very serious outsiders .

 Diaz/Rubio secure their status 

La  TS1 Diaz / Rubio  continues its flawless run by dominating  Fauvelle / Stroppiana .

The favorites are living up to expectations and confirming their status as the pair to beat in this tournament.

 Open semi-finals 

The final four are now known:

  •  Diaz / Rubio (TS1) vs Armand / Maître 
  •  Brechemier / Gourre (TS2) vs Tullou / Vial (TS8) 

Between strong favorites and confident outsiders, everything remains open.
